Key Cost Factors

  • Type of Water Heater: The choice between a standard tank water heater and a tankless unit significantly impacts the cost. Tankless installations are generally more expensive, ranging from $2,400 and up, compared to standard tank installations which typically fall between $1,600 and $2,400.
  • Existing Setup & Modifications: If the installation requires significant modifications to existing plumbing, gas lines, or electrical wiring, the cost will increase. Complex installations needing major modifications can push jobs into the $2,400–$3,900 range.
  • Water Heater Capacity: Larger capacity tank water heaters often cost more than smaller ones. For example, a 40-gallon gas-powered water heater, including purchase and installation, can range from $900 to $3,000 or more.
  • Permits and Inspections: Depending on local regulations in Columbus, GA, permits might be required, adding to the overall project cost. Contractors should factor in these administrative fees and any necessary inspection costs.
  • Disposal of Old Unit: Removing and properly disposing of the old water heater is often included in installation quotes but can sometimes be an additional fee. It's important to clarify this with the client.

Tips for Pricing Jobs

  1. Conduct a Thorough On-Site Assessment: Always inspect the existing setup to identify potential complexities such as old plumbing that needs updating, electrical panel capacity issues for electric tankless units, or ventilation requirements for gas models. This prevents unexpected costs and allows for accurate quoting.
  2. Itemize Your Quotes Clearly: Break down costs for the water heater unit, labor, materials (like expansion tanks, new valves, or strapping), permit fees, and disposal. Transparency helps build client trust and justifies your pricing, especially for jobs in the Mid-range ($1,600–$2,400) or Premium ($2,400–$3,900) tiers.
  3. Factor in Local Labor Rates: While national averages exist, adjust your labor costs to reflect the Columbus, GA market. Professional plumbers typically charge an average of $148 per hour, but this can vary. Ensure your hourly rate covers your overhead and desired profit margin.
  4. Offer Tiered Options: Provide clients with options corresponding to the Basic, Mid-range, and Premium tiers. For example, a basic quote for a standard tank replacement ($900-$1,600), a mid-range for a slightly more complex tank installation ($1,600-$2,400), and a premium option for a tankless or highly customized installation ($2,400-$3,900). This empowers clients to choose based on their budget and needs.
